
Housing costs in Westfield Center?
A typical home costs
$311,700, which is 7.8% less expensive than the national average of
$338,100 and 58.2% more expensive than the average Ohio home, at
$197,000.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Westfield Center costs
$960 per month, which is 2.0% cheaper than the national average of
$980 and 4.2% cheaper than the state average of
$1,000.
Can I afford Westfield Center?
To live comfortably in Westfield Center (zip 44251), Ohio, a minimum annual income of
$59,760 for a family, and
$31,600 for a single person is recommended.
